Database of Anti-Environment Votes in the 112th Congress
Committee on Energy and Commerce, Democratic Staff
In the 112th Congress, the House of Representatives voted 317 times to block action to address climate change, to halt efforts to reduce air and water pollution, to undermine protections for public lands and coastal areas, and to weaken the protection of the environment in other ways.
